What are CAD drawings primarily used for in architectural design?

CAD drawings are primarily used in architectural design to produce digital representations that facilitate construction and design processes. These drawings allow architects to create precise and scalable models of buildings, including detailed plans, elevations, and sections. This digital format enhances collaboration among various stakeholders, including engineers, contractors, and clients, by ensuring that everyone works with the same accurate and detailed information.

Using CAD software also enables architects to make quick adjustments to designs, perform simulations, and generate different views of the project efficiently. As a result, these tools significantly streamline the design process, reduce errors, and improve overall communication.
